全球診斷心電圖市場預計將從 2025 年的 84.8 億美元成長到 2031 年的 128.1 億美元,複合年成長率為 7.12%。

這些設備旨在捕捉並記錄特定時間內的心臟電活動,是檢測心肌梗塞和心律不整等心臟異常的重要工具。推動該市場發展的主要經濟因素是全球心血管疾病盛行率的上升,這使得頻繁且準確的心臟監測對於有效的患者照護至關重要。此外,儘管技術不斷進步,但老年人口的成長(老年人更容易患慢性心臟疾病)仍持續推動著對這些診斷設備的基本需求。

儘管成長指標強勁,但由於缺乏能夠準確解讀複雜心電圖結果的熟練醫務人員,該行業仍面臨許多挑戰。這可能導致診斷瓶頸,阻礙高效率的工作流程。鑑於需要治療的患者數量龐大,醫療保健系統承受著巨大的壓力。根據美國心臟協會預測,到2024年,美國將有約1.269億成年人患有某種形式的心血管疾病。如此巨大的疾病負擔凸顯了對便捷的診斷解決方案和訓練有素的醫務人員進行有效診療的迫切需求。

市場促進因素

將人工智慧 (AI) 和機器學習技術應用於心電圖判讀,正在成為市場上的變革力量,從根本上改變了診斷流程和可近性。這些技術透過自動檢測複雜心律不整,提高了臨床診斷的準確性和速度,從而緩解了專科醫生嚴重短缺的問題,同時也促進了先進診斷工具在非醫院環境中的應用。這項技術進步正在迅速擴展硬體的功能。例如,Healio 在 2024 年 6 月報道稱,FDA 已核准一款新型的 AI 賦能攜帶式12 導聯心電圖系統,該系統能夠區分 35 種不同的心臟觀察,顯著提升了攜帶式設備在即時應用中的診斷效用。

同時,穿戴式和攜帶式心電圖監測設備的快速普及,透過實現持續的遠端心電圖監測,正在改變患者照護方式。這一趨勢推動了整個行業向門診護理的轉變,使醫療系統能夠在維持嚴格監測標準的同時,降低與長期住院相關的成本。這些遠端解決方案的臨床和經濟價值是市場上的關鍵差異化因素。皇家飛利浦公司2024年5月發布的新聞稿重點介紹了一項研究,該研究表明,使用行動門診心臟遙測的患者再入院率(30.2%)顯著低於使用植入式循環記錄儀的患者(35.4%)。隨著心臟護理經濟影響的不斷擴大,這種效率的提升至關重要。美國心臟協會在2024年預測,到2050年,美國與心血管疾病相關的年度醫療費用將增加近四倍,達到1.49兆美元。

市場挑戰

熟練醫療專業人員的短缺是診斷性心電圖市場成長的主要阻礙因素。儘管對心臟監測的需求不斷成長,但由於訓練有素的技術人員和心臟病專家的短缺,處理和解讀診斷數據的能力受到限制。這種短缺造成了營運瓶頸,患者吞吐量受限於結果分析的速度,而非設備的可用性。因此,醫療機構可能會推遲購買額外的心電圖設備,因為在人員沒有相應增加的情況下增加硬體庫存並不能轉化為患者管理整體效率的提高。

診斷程序需求量與可用醫護人員數量之間的不平衡直接影響市場收入。醫院被迫優先處理現有病例,而非投資擴充設備,導致設備更新週期延長,採購率降低。近期行業數據也印證了這項醫護人員短缺問題的嚴重性。 2024年,美國醫學院協會(AAMC)報告稱,預計到2036年,美國將面臨高達8.6萬名醫生的缺口。專科醫務人員的持續短缺凸顯了複雜診斷能力的不足,從而限制了製造商的潛在市場規模。

市場趨勢

智慧型手機連接的攜帶式心電圖儀正從消費級醫療保健領域向嚴謹的臨床應用領域發展,利用大型資料集實現醫療級精準度。這些設備透過採用與傳統12導聯系統相媲美的深度學習模型,將先進的診斷功能直接賦予患者,從而改變全球診斷心電圖市場。這種能力的提升得益於海量心臟數據的積累,這些數據不斷最佳化檢測演算法,使其能夠即時應用於臨床診療。根據《心血管商業》(Cardiovascular Business)2024年6月的一篇報導報道,新核准的KAI 12L技術基於超過175萬份心電圖進行訓練,使這款攜帶式設備能夠識別包括心肌梗塞在內的多種疾病。

同時,隨著製造商克服訊號雜訊和資料過載等歷史難題,無線和無導線心電圖架構(尤其是植入式心臟監視器 (ICM))的普及速度正在加快。與傳統的外部貼片和有線動態心電圖監測不同,這些無導線植入可提供長期皮下監測,但以往卻因大量誤報而給臨床醫生帶來負擔。近期技術進步已將先進演算法直接整合到這些無導線設計中,透過在傳輸前過濾非臨床偽影來提高診斷準確性和操作效率。例如,《心臟節律新聞》在2024年4月報道,採用SmartECG技術的新型Biomonitor IV植入式心臟監視器可整體主要心律不整的誤報率降低86%,從而顯著簡化醫療團隊的審查流程。

The Global Diagnostic Electrocardiograph Market is projected to expand from USD 8.48 Billion in 2025 to USD 12.81 Billion by 2031, registering a CAGR of 7.12%. These devices, designed to capture and record the heart's electrical activity over specific durations, serve as essential tools for detecting cardiac abnormalities like myocardial infarctions and arrhythmias. The primary economic force driving this market is the rising global prevalence of cardiovascular diseases, which necessitates frequent and precise cardiac monitoring for effective patient care. Additionally, the growing geriatric population, a demographic statistically more prone to chronic heart conditions, continues to reinforce the fundamental demand for these diagnostic instruments, irrespective of technological advancements.

Despite these strong growth indicators, the industry faces a substantial hurdle due to a shortage of skilled healthcare professionals qualified to accurately interpret complex electrocardiogram results, which can cause diagnostic bottlenecks and hinder efficient workflows. This strain on healthcare systems is significant considering the high volume of patients requiring attention. As reported by the American Heart Association in 2024, approximately 126.9 million adults in the United States were living with some form of cardiovascular disease. This immense disease burden highlights the critical need for accessible diagnostic solutions and a trained workforce to manage the caseload effectively.

Market Driver

The integration of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ning into ECG interpretation represents a transformative force in the market, fundamentally changing diagnostic workflows and accessibility. These technologies help mitigate the critical shortage of specialists by automating the detection of complex arrhythmias, thereby improving clinical accuracy and speed while facilitating the deployment of advanced diagnostic tools in non-hospital environments. This technological progression is rapidly broadening hardware capabilities; for instance, Healio reported in June 2024 that the FDA cleared a new AI-enabled handheld 12-lead ECG system capable of identifying 35 different cardiac determinations, significantly expanding the diagnostic utility of portable devices for immediate clinical use.

Concurrently, the rapid proliferation of wearable and portable ECG monitoring devices is reshaping patient management by enabling continuous, remote cardiac surveillance. This trend supports the industry-wide shift toward ambulatory care, allowing healthcare systems to reduce costs associated with long-term hospitalization while maintaining rigorous oversight standards. The clinical and economic value of these remote solutions is a key market differentiator; a May 2024 press release from Royal Philips highlighted a study showing that patients utilizing mobile cardiac outpatient telemetry had a significantly lower readmission rate of 30.2% compared to 35.4% for those with implantable loop recorders. Such efficiency is vital as the economic impact of heart care grows, with the American Heart Association projecting in 2024 that annual U.S. health care costs for cardiovascular conditions will nearly quadruple to $1,490 billion by 2050.

Market Challenge

The scarcity of skilled healthcare professionals acts as a major constraint on the growth of the diagnostic electrocardiograph market. Although the demand for cardiac monitoring is increasing, the capacity to process and interpret the resulting diagnostic data is limited by a lack of trained technicians and cardiologists. This deficit creates operational bottlenecks where patient throughput is restricted not by device availability, but by the speed of result analysis. Consequently, healthcare facilities may delay purchasing additional electrocardiograph units, as increasing hardware inventories without a corresponding increase in workforce capacity fails to improve overall patient management efficiency.

This imbalance between the volume of required diagnostic procedures and the available workforce directly impacts market revenue. Hospitals are forced to prioritize managing existing caseloads rather than investing in fleet expansion, leading to extended replacement cycles and reduced procurement rates. The severity of this workforce issue is underscored by recent industry data; the Association of American Medical Colleges reported in 2024 that the United States faces a projected shortage of up to 86,000 physicians by 2036. This persistent lack of specialty care providers highlights the limited capacity to handle complex diagnostics, thereby restricting the total addressable market for manufacturers.

Market Trends

The evolution of smartphone-connected handheld ECG devices is shifting beyond consumer wellness into rigorous clinical application, utilizing massive datasets to achieve medical-grade precision. These devices are transforming the Global Diagnostic Electrocardiograph Market by placing sophisticated diagnostic capabilities directly into patients' hands, supported by deep learning models that rival traditional 12-lead systems. This capability is driven by the aggregation of vast amounts of cardiac data which refines detection algorithms for immediate point-of-care use; according to a June 2024 Cardiovascular Business article, the newly approved KAI 12L technology was trained on data from over 1.75 million ECGs, enabling the handheld device to provide determinations for a wide range of conditions, including myocardial infarctions.

Simultaneously, the adoption of wireless and leadless ECG architectures, particularly insertable cardiac monitors (ICMs), is accelerating as manufacturers resolve historical issues regarding signal noise and data overload. Unlike traditional external patches or wired Holter monitors, these leadless implants offer long-term subcutaneous monitoring but have previously burdened clinicians with high volumes of false alerts. Recent advancements now integrate sophisticated algorithms directly into these leadless designs to filter non-clinical artifacts before transmission, enhancing diagnostic yield and operational efficiency. For instance, Cardiac Rhythm News reported in April 2024 that the new Biomonitor IV insertable cardiac monitor features SmartECG technology that reduces false detections by 86% across all major arrhythmias, significantly streamlining the review process for care teams.
